Transaction 71d679f86632fc3e75e74511a1db0e81e020c36aed939bdb7940978222341e09
2 Input
2 Outputs
- 71d679f86632fc3e75e74511a1db0e81e020c36aed939bdb7940978222341e09:0
- 71d679f86632fc3e75e74511a1db0e81e020c36aed939bdb7940978222341e09:1
value 701839
address 16AdF5PTf6AriLcKvzUL5Q3u3erCwPns7m
value 1188110
address 1FRPwwWJ9AeKSi8PdPXBEQrX5WGcSbQZGa